Summary

Caterpillar Inc. (CAT) filed an 8-K on July 23, 2013, to provide supplemental information regarding dealer statistics for retail sales of machines and power systems for the three-month rolling period ending June 2013. This data, based on unaudited reports from independent dealers, offers insights into the company's sales performance by region and business sector. The report aims to help investors better understand Caterpillar's business dynamics and the industries it serves, acknowledging that dealer deliveries to end-users may lag Caterpillar's sales to dealers. The disclosed statistics reveal a mixed performance across different segments and geographies. While Machine Retail Sales saw a notable decline in Asia/Pacific and North America, with the World also experiencing a downturn, Power Systems demonstrated some resilience. Specifically, Electric Power, Industrial, and Transportation sectors within Power Systems showed positive growth in June 2013, although the overall Power Systems segment experienced a slight dip for the three-month period. This report serves as a supplementary disclosure and does not alter Caterpillar's previously reported financial results.
